Chester Hill High School is a comprehensive, coeducational secondary school serving students from Year 7 to Year 12, located in Chester Hill, NSW, on the Country of the Darug Nation (Cabrigal People). The school operates in partnership with families and the local community to support students' high aspirations, with quality teaching and learning grounded in creativity and integrity forming the foundation of its educational approach. This partnership model reflects a deliberate effort to connect the school's work to the broader community it serves. The school's vision describes a nurturing, inclusive, and safe environment designed to inspire each student to become a creative lifelong learner and courageous global citizen, equipping young people to face future challenges with confidence.
